Retinol is a type of Vitamin A that occurs naturally in foods like carrots, spinach, and seafood.
Your nails are made up of keratin, a type of protein that is also found in your hair and skin. Without proper care, your nails can become thinner and more brittle, but there are many ways to keep your nails strong and healthy.

There's no denying that balayage is having a moment. This modern hair coloring technique has taken the beauty world by storm, and it's easy to see why. Balayage is a French word meaning "to sweep" or "to paint", and that's exactly what the colorist does.
